DislikedThe GMT+3 you mentioned earlier is your broker timezone ie not necessarily the same as your local (pc) timezone.
The idea is to show the London Open (8 am London currently gmt+1) in your own timezone. From what you have said, the London open is showing as 9 am. This would suggest that you live in a time zone of gmt+2 (including any dst adjustment)? At a guess, you could likely live in Europe?Ignored
